Recent U.S. employment data has shown significantly lower numbers than expected, raising concerns about the state of the economy.
Weak Employment Data
Forecasts had called for 75,000 new jobs with a 4.3% unemployment rate. However, the latest figures are significantly lower, which is considered bad news for the U.S. economy. This data comes after a series of weaker indicators, including downward revisions of prior months that erased over 250,000 jobs.
Impact on Bitcoin
The significantly lower jobs number strengthens the case for imminent and potentially deeper Fed rate cuts. This could be seen as a bullish development for Bitcoin, as looser monetary policy injects more liquidity into financial markets and tends to push investors toward riskier assets.
Connection to Macroeconomics
Regardless of the outcome, Bitcoin’s trajectory is increasingly tethered to macroeconomic data. The direction of the labor market will help determine the pace of Fed easing and, by extension, the level of liquidity available for digital assets. Today’s employment report reinforces just how intertwined crypto markets have become with traditional economic cycles.
The state of the labor market and related monetary policy will continue to have a significant impact on Bitcoin and the cryptocurrency market as a whole.
